Description
This book comprehensively examines children's ideas about death, both biological and religious. Written by specialists from developmental psychology, pediatrics, philosophy, anthropology and legal studies, it offers a truly interdisciplinary approach to the topic. It examines different conceptions of death and their impact on children's cognitive and emotional development.
